Side-by-Side Comparison

Feature dente deste
Definition estrutura calcárea, dura, geralmente esmaltada, presente na boca dos animais vertebrados, usada para cortar, arrancar, triturar e moer alimentos, assim como para defesa e ataque contração da preposição de com o pronome ou determinante demonstrativo este:
